21 years 8 months =
months?

Answers

Answer:

260 months.

Step-by-step explanation:

Since there are 12 months in per year,

12 ⋅ 21 = 252.

There are 252 months in 21 years.

Then add the months left over.

252 + 8 = 260.

There are 260 months in 21 years, 8 months.

What is the measure of angle D

Answers

Answer:

52 degrees

Step-by-step explanation:

A triangle's angles all add up to 180 degrees so we can create this equation:

x + 20 + 3x + 32 = 180

Combine like terms.

x + 3x + 20 + 32 = 180

4x + 52 = 180

Subtract 52 from both sides.

4x = 128

Divide.

128 / 4 = 32

x = 32

Plug in the value of x.

x + 20

32 + 20

52

Angle D is equal to 52 degrees.

Sherane rolls a standard, six-sided number cube. Find p (not composite).

Answers

Answer:

2/3

Step-by-step explanation:

A six sided number cube :

Sample space = (1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6)

Non composite numbers on a six sided number cube = (1, 2, 3, 5)

Probability of an event = required outcome / Total possible outcomes

Required outcome = number of non composite numbers = 4

Total possible outcomes = sample space = 6

P(not composite) = 4 / 6 = 2/3
